This “Art Thursday” we invited visitors to ‘step into the spotlight’ as a participant in a work of art. The piece, ‘Limit of Projection I,’ created by David Lamela, is an interactive conceptual artwork that consists of a single spotlight illuminating a darkened gallery. Students were photographed in the spotlight by USF MFA graduate, Jim Reiman.
